    I agree entirely. The article said he has two prior DWI arrests but not whether those arrests resulted in convictions. New Jersey law is pretty strict on repeat offenders, but he won't be considered a repeat offender unless he has a prior conviction or prior convictions.

    Don't underestimate the impact of the gun charge. That's the kind of charge that could land him in jail. We'll see.

    Yeah, it's bad. I didn't know he had 3 of them. I think this guy literally drank away his contract and that's why he failed on the Jets. The guy needs help.

    In NJ if you get 3 DUIS within 10 years, you lose your license for 10 years and get the interlock breathalyzer device on your car for 1-3 years AFTER the suspension is up. He might get jail time for the gun.
